Squatters Arrested After Occupying Mono Way Building

Sonora, CA…The property owner of a building located on the 13000 block of Mono Way in Sonora called the Tuolumne County Sheriff’s Office ‪Wednesday morning‬ after he discovered squatters inside. Deputies arrived a short time later and surrounded the building before ordering the subjects outside. 47-year-old Jerome Zylstra, 32-year-old Brian Shrader, 39-year-old Jessica Gogas, and 41-year-old Jeremy Tosto exited the building.

During a search Zylstra was found to be in possession of methamphetamine and Gogas and Tosto were in possession of drug paraphernalia. A records check showed Zylstra had an outstanding arrest warrant and Shrader had been released from custody on his own recognizance from a prior case. The property owner estimated several hundred dollars worth of damage had been caused by the squatters. The four were arrested for burglary and various other charges.

The two dogs who were with the group were turned over to a Tuolumne County Animal Control Officer for care.
